
East Ridge Goalie, Nick Dwyer, The Fifth Member of Inaugural Keiser University Recruiting Class

The Keiser Seahawks Men’s Lacrosse Coach, Patrick Johnston, announced Nick Dwyer as the fifth member of his inaugural recruiting class. Dwyer is a 6-2, 230 pound goalie from East Ridge HS in Clermont, Florida.
Nick was awarded East Ridge High School’s One Knight Award as a senior for “being an overall great player with a great attitude towards the team.”
Dwyer started all 11 games for the Knights, turning away 112 shots on goal and earning an overall save percentage of 56% in his senior campaign.
“Nick is a real presence in the cage,” Coach Johnston stated. “He sees the ball, he has great vision in the clearing game, and moves remarkably quick for a big man. Nick is also a real competitor and a team-first kind of player which will help us establish a dynamic culture here at Keiser.”
Dwyer added, “I chose Keiser because it gives me the ability to stay in Florida and further my education and start a life for myself. Also because this is the first year Keiser will have a men’s lacrosse team, I’m looking forward to starting program and expanding it. I have high expectations for my future team and hope to bring home a championship.”
Nick will be majoring in Sports Management.
